Как задать стили input отдельно только для текста?

Как задать стили input отдельно только для текста ?
Есть input которому задан бордер з opacity: 0.3; кого задаешь его всему инпуту то оно применяется и к тексту, а мне надо чтоб только к бордеру как мне это решить ?

Дополнительно:

Ответы:

Укажи бордеру цвет с альфа каналом, вместо прозрачности всего инпута

 

Для решения данной проблемы вы можете воспользоваться услугами фрилансеров. Мы выполним необходимую работу быстро и качественно.

 

    • Как задать стили input отдельно только для текста?Есть ответ
    • 09.04.2024
    Ответить

    Чтобы задать стили input отдельно только для текста, можно воспользоваться атрибутом type и классами CSS. Например, если вы хотите стилизовать input только для ввода текста, вы можете использовать следующий код:

    А затем в CSS файле определить стили для класса .text-input:

    Таким образом, все input элементы с классом .text-input будут иметь заданные стили только для ввода текста. Вы можете также добавить другие свойства CSS в зависимости от ваших потребностей.

    Если у вас есть другие типы input элементов, такие как email, password и т. д., вы можете также создать отдельные классы для них и задать им соответствующие стили.

    Надеюсь, это поможет вам стилизовать input элементы на вашем сайте! Если у вас есть дополнительные вопросы, не стесняйтесь задавать.

    • Как задать стили input отдельно только для текста?Есть ответ
    • 07.04.2024
    Ответить

    Для того чтобы задать стили input отдельно только для текста, вам необходимо использовать псевдоэлемент ::placeholder в CSS. Этот псевдоэлемент позволяет стилизовать текст, который отображается внутри пустого input до того момента, пока пользователь не введет свои данные.

    Пример использования:

    html

    css
    input::placeholder {
    color: red;
    font-style: italic;
    }

    В данном примере текст, который будет отображаться внутри input до ввода данных, будет иметь красный цвет и курсивное начертание.

    Если вы хотите применить стили только к введенным данным, то вам нужно использовать псевдоэлемент :valid. Например:

    html

    css
    input:valid {
    border: 2px solid green;
    }

    В данном примере после ввода данных в input и их валидации (например, если поле обязательно для заполнения), рамка вокруг input станет зеленой.

    Таким образом, вы можете легко задавать стили как для текста внутри input до ввода данных, так и для введенных данных с помощью CSS псевдоэлементов.

Оставить комментарий